Year-round change in gelation of bassy chub (Kyphosus lembus) meat, collected from October 2001 to September 2002 off the coast of Nagasaki, was investigated. The fish meat exhibited a similar high gel-forming ability for all seasons, including pre-and post-spawning seasons. Freshwater washing of the meat did not improve its gel-forming ability. It was concluded that bassy chub meat could be used for thermal gel production in all seasons.
